The MHT CET 2024 round 1 cutoff percentile for the Bachelor of Engineering [BE] (Electrical Engineering) at NIT was 35.22 for the TFWS category.
Round | Cutoff |
---|---|
Round 1 | 35.22 |
Round 2 | 47.01 |
Round 3 | 50.93 |
The JEE Main 2023 round 2 cutoff rank for the Bachelor of Engineering [BE] (Electrical Engineering) at NIT was 65696 for the General category.
Round | Cutoff |
---|---|
Round 2 | 65696 |
Round 3 | 52956 |
The Maharashtra JEE Main 2022 round 1 cutoff rank for the Bachelor of Engineering [BE] (Electrical Engineering) at NIT was 59657 for the General category.
Round | Cutoff |
---|---|
Round 1 | 59657 |
Round 2 | 50415 |
Round 3 | 46528 |

Aspirants seeking admission to the program should have passed 10+2 from a recognized board.
Fee Structure:-
Category | Fees | Other Fees | Total Fees |
Open & OMS | 96000/- | 5000/- | 101000/- |
OBC (Above Income 8 lac | 96000/- | 5000/- | 101000/- |
OBC (Below Income 8 lac | 53522/- | 5000/- | 58522/- |
SBS/VJ/DT/NT(above income 8 lac) | 96000/- | 5000/- | 101000/- |
SBS/VJ/DT/NT(above income 8 lac) | 11043 | 5000/- | 16043/- |
SC & ST (Maharashtra State Student) | NIL | 5000/- | 5000/- |
